    Giglio: 'Sixers need more from Joel Embiid'

    Joel Embiid

    "Here's where I'm at on Embiid, they need more out of him," Giglio said at the beginning of Monday's 94WIP Midday Show with Hugh Douglas. "I understand he's not one hundred percent, but that's the story of every postseason. They need more. The only way they win this series, in my eyes, is if he plays better than he did the other night. He had eight rebounds in 37 minutes. Let me say that again, eight rebounds in 37 minutes on the court.

    "In the fourth quarter on Saturday night, Joel Embiid was 0-5 from the field, 0-2 from three and had zero rebounds. This is now nine straight playoff games he has shot under 50-percent. Is it too much for me to ask for Joel Embiid to be the MVP of the regular season in the playoffs?"

    After an incredible first quarter, Embiid appeared to re-injury his left knee on a self alley-oop dunk in the second quarter. Embiid returned to the game but finished just 8-22 from the field and 2-8 from three and the Sixers fell 111-104, as the Knicks took over late winning the fourth quarter by 10 points.

    To be fair, the Sixers got 62 of their 104 points from Embiid and Tyrese Maxey and Kyle Lowry added 18. After that, their fourth highest scorer was Kelly Oubre Jr. with 10 points. The Sixers' bench scored a total of just seven points, as Buddy Hield (0-1 3FG) and Nic Batum (1-4 3FG) struggled.

    Both Embiid and Maxey, who is sick, are questionable for tonight's Game 2 against the Knicks in New York. Philadelphia is five point underdogs.
